Analysis

Mali recorded 13,952 kt for agrifood systems — emissions (co2eq) from n2o in 2023. That is the highest value across all 34 years on record.

The figure is up 4.6% on the previous year and up 40.0% over ten years.

Over the whole period, agrifood systems — emissions (co2eq) from n2o in Mali peaked at 13,952 kt in 2023 and was at its lowest, 5,492 kt, in 1991.

Mali ranks 36th of 222 countries on this measure, in the top quarter.

The long-run direction has been consistently rising across the 34 years of available data.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
